Pack Your Bags...For The Journey Ahead

Mountain ClimbingEvery Real Estate transaction is like a Journey.  For this trip I, as a Realtor, will be your tour guide.  As a team we will overcome obstacles thrown our way and make it to the top of the Mountain, your new home.  There are several members of our team.  You as a buyer or seller, myself the Realtor as a tour guide, the Lender that in a sense holds the map, and many others that will represent Landmarks along the way.

To make it to the top it is important to know the team.  It is important to find team members that are the most qualified to lead you.  Let's go through a list of team members you will need and what assets they will bring to the team.

Your Realtor- Or myself if you choose me to be on your team.  Your Realtor will be your guide toward each plateau and use their expertise to keep the pack moving forward instead of falling behind or going downhill.  Here are some of the plateaus for buyers and sellers:

  • Listing the home including marketing, photos, pricing, coordinate showings and guidance through what can be the rough terrain of negotiating.
  • Finding homes that fit your criteria.  There may be many mountains and trails, but let's find just the right one to take us to the top.
  • Contract Deadlines.  There are many checkpoints along the way.  Let's make sure we have just the right tools for our needs.
  • We will again see more Negotiating terrain.  Make sure your guide has the knowledge and expertise to get you through.

Your Lender- The lender plays a key role in getting to the top.  There are many trails to choose from here as well.  Choosing the right one from the beginning will get you to the top with less pitfalls.  Make sure the lender you choose holds a compass with the right points.  Ask a lot of questions and make sure the path is right for your needs.

Your Inspectors-  The Licensed Inspectors will help the team know what obstacles to overcome near the top.  Choosing the right inspector is imperative to help the rest of the team (you, your agent and lender) make sure we are still on the right path.  If there are repairs that need to be done prior to closing we may need to change it up a bit.  Also, there may be a canyon up the trail and we may need to find a completely different mountain.  Make sure you choose good, reputable inspectors that will make you feel positive you are making the right decision on the house you are buying.  After we get to the top, the team wants you to be happy and not find any surprises.

Your Title Company-  The Title Company plays a subtle yet important role in the transaction.  The Title Company is in charge of getting relevant information to the lender to process your loan in a timely fashion.  They also run title searches to make sure the mountain you are about to own is free and clear of Dark Clouds at closing.  If there are liens on the property, you need to know now.  Efficiency of the Title Company will help make the transaction more desirable.

Your Homeowner's Insurance Company-  All of your Homeowner's Insurance needs must be planned prior to closing.  Actually, I recommend this part of the team join in during the inspection period.  If there are any surprises in Rates, let's find out while we are still close to the bottom.  Call your insurance company early on to make sure you are getting a good rate and a desirable Insurance Package.

As a team we will make the Journey a Positive one to remember.  Every one of these team members play a key role in your happiness at the top.  Before, During and After you sell your home and move in to the new one, your team will be behind you 100%.  Make sure you choose the right team before you get to the Mountain.
